Dr. Ruxandra Carp is a psychiatrist practicing in Winchester, Massachusetts . Dr. Carp is a medical doctor specializing in the care of mental health patients. As a psychiatrist, Dr. Carp diagnoses and treats mental illnesses. Dr. Carp may treat patients through a variety of methods including medications, psychotherapy or talk therapy, psychosocial interventions and more, depending on each individual case. Different medications that a psychiatrist might prescribe include antidepressants, antipsychotic mediations, mood stabilizers, stimulants, sedatives and hypnotics. Dr. Carp treats conditions like depression, anxiety, OCD, eating disorders, bipolar disorders, personality disorders, insomnia, ADD and other mental illnesses.
